Multi font family / color / size selector for users
How to limit font selection for monogram
Specify a special price for certain symbols
Custom user text
With the help of this instruction you can not just add text, but give the buyer the opportunity to choose from the options for color, size and font. We present you a powerful tool for working with text layers.
One color, one font, one size.
If you do not need more than one type of font design - you need to perform just a couple of simple actions.
If you want to allow your users add some text (monogram), for example, print on a T-shirt, you need to do the following:
First of all, First of all, add a new "text field" category.
If you need a simple text monogram, select “Text Monogram Field” or “Long Text Monogram Field”, but if you need complex functionality for wholesale engraving then choose “Engraving For Wholesale” use this article for more information Customization - Text Engraving For Wholesale / Qty Based Unique Text With Templates .
Fill in the following fields
Title: any title, the more descriptive the better.
Type: "Text Monogram Field", "Long Text Monogram Field”.
Save
The next step is to add Option.
Fill in the following fields
- Label: some name, the more descriptive the better.
- Default value: any word or characters that will be displayed by default.
3-4. Set Min and Max Length: the number of characters that the client can enter.
- Check the box "Charge Per Character" if you need a feature that allows you to charge for each character from engraving.
- Set the price per text in total or per character.
Save
The next step is to create the layer.
Fill in the following fields
- Title: some name, the more descriptive the better.
- Type: Text. (IMPORTANT: if you would like to have 'bridge or curved effect' or limit the size of the textbox within certain space and increase / decrease the space between the letters automatically based on how many letters are entered - use 'Curved' Text Layer.
- View: Select the view in which the text will be displayed.
- Text: Text to be displayed until custom text is entered.
Go to the Logic tab if you need to specify special conditions for displaying this text. If you want it to be always available, then do not add anything. Guide for Logic Conditional Logic Rules For Displaying Options / Categories / Tabs.
Go to the Advanced Tab.
Fill in the following fields
- Font size
- Font family
- Always uppercase or not
- Font style (Normal, Bold, Italic)
- Vertical Alignment (for Text monogram with a certain width or Long text monogram)
- Horizontal alignment
Save
Scroll down
- Turn on automatic text width or set it
- Font colour
3-5. Text source, specify the one we created at the beginning.
6. Save
Most of the settings can be customized so that clients can change them themselves.
Multi font family / color / size selector for users
Here is the result
This article may be helpful:
Conditional Logic Rules For Displaying Options / Categories / Tabs
Customization - Text Engraving For Wholesale / Qty Based Unique Text With Templates
Multi font family / color / size selector for users
To allow customers change font family color or size you need to create appropriate categories and assign them in the custom layer advanced tab:
- Color Thumbnail Category Type - for changing the color. Read more about Color Thumbnail Category Type. Assign created category with color options to custom layer of type 'Text' or 'Curved Text'.
- "Font Family" and "Font Size" Category Types are described in the video below.
They allow you to bind your values to a specific custom layer to a category of 'Font Family' or Font Size type. - This allows the user to change the font size and font type using dropdowns list on the frontend
- You can also link font size to the "Dropdown" or "Text List" categories.
How to limit font selection for monogram
Sometimes customers want to choose a specific font for engraving, but there are too many types and It becomes so hard to choose. Now you can provide a limited amount of font types in Custom Product Builder.
In order to choose what fonts are allowed on the user frontend - please go to Actions > Fonts Manager. Fonts that are in the right column will be displayed on the frontend.
Charge Per Character Feature
The application has a feature that allows you to charge for each character from engraving.
To use this function, please do the following:
First of all you need to add the necessary category. You can use one of these categories: "Text Monogram Field", "Long Text Monogram Field" or "Engraving for Wholesale".
Fill in the following fields
Title: any title, the more descriptive the better.
Type: "Text Monogram Field", "Long Text Monogram Field" or "Engraving for Wholesale".
Save
The next step is to add parameters.
Fill in the following fields
1. Label: some name, the more descriptive the better.
2. Default value: any word or characters that will be displayed by default.
3-4. Set Min and Max Length: the number of characters that the client can enter.
5. Check the box "Charge Per Character".
6. Possibility to specify a special price for certain symbols
7. Сheck the box if you want to consider space as a symbol
8. Set the price per character.
Save
Here is the result.
Use Custom Character Prices From General CPB Settings
If you want to charge money for a symbol and at the same time specify a special price for certain symbols, you can use the Custom Character Prices feature. All you have to do is add all these symbols to General CPB Settings and enable this feature.
Go to General Settings.
Add all the necessary symbols and set a price for them.
Save.
To edit or delete a character press the button as shown below.
The next step is to configure the text input option. Any symbol can be put in the text input.
1. To make this function available, first activate the "Charge Per Character" function.
2. Now you can activate the "Use Custom Character Prices" function.
3. Specify prices for regular symbols.
4. Save.
Here is the result.
IMPORTANT: To make sure the product categories / options are saved properly – first click SAVE at the bottom of the category / panel / option screen, and only after that the SAVE button at the top of the page.
Comments
0 comments
Please sign in to leave a comment.